I didn't se the original message re the fruit flies , but I assume the response that referred to vinegar was to fill a small bowl with vinegar, cover with cling wrap and puncture the wrap with a toothpick several times. The little buggers crawl in for treats , can't find their way out and DIE! A lot better than trying to swat them !
